    Key to data analysis to drive growth in African aviation

    Aviation analytics expert Cirium agrees to a strategic partnership with the African Aviation Association (AFRAA) and promotes growth in the continent's aviation sector through an enhanced analytical framework.

    According to Cirium, cooperation with the Airline Trade Association is at a critical time as 2024 saw a 27% increase in international passenger flights with Africa from the previous year.

    Rapid growth presents opportunities for airlines on the continent, says Jeremy Bowen, CEO of Cirium:

    Insights gathered from Cirium's analytics solutions, including the DIIO SRS Analyzer for strategic scheduling insights, promote Fleet Analaser for fleet planning and sustainability initiatives, allowing airlines across the continent to plan, respond efficiently and unlock new revenue opportunities.

    AFRAA held its 13th stakeholder convention in Kigali, Africa this week, and this latest collaboration, as highlighted this week, will align with its strategy, improving connectivity, reducing operational costs, increasing sustainability and fostering digital transformation across the sector.

    “The use of data-driven tools is critical to providing intelligence to stakeholders in airlines, airports, governments, regulators and other industry to maintain and enhance aviation in Africa.” In partnership with Cirium, he added, “We will accelerate our ability to meet data needs and ensure we are ahead of the rapidly evolving market.”
